Default Re: worst red light debate, again!

Mr. Dedman, it appears the only thing to equalize foul start jeopardy across all categories, is to find a way to institute a “first” situation into heads up races.

Now, this will take some thought, as how do you convert a heads up run to equal status of a handicap run?

Faster qualifiers seem to be the logical choice here. Be it Pro Stock or Stock, the higher qualified car should be exempt from any dual red light race: If both cars in a heads up race foul, the car that qualified higher will be the winner. There is no problem with writing this into the software: It is simple “if…then…else…endif” programming.

Would this make less sense than what is in place now? It seems it would be a fair way of one-car foul- start jeopardy in ALL races.

FIRST RED LIGHT FOR EVERYONE!
